ronram5126 / steamworkshopdownloader

Simple steam workshop downlaoder
MIT License
21 stars 7 forks source link

Error on npm start #1

Closed craigyu closed 4 years ago

craigyu commented 4 years ago

I get this error when I run npm start. The urls examples look like file url not collection url, I tried both and none worked. :(


> node index.js

/Users/craigyu/Downloads/steamWorkshopCrawler/steamworkshopdownloader-master/node_modules/jsdom/lib/jsdom/living/helpers/dates-and-times.js:235
  } catch {
          ^

SyntaxError: Unexpected token {
    at createScript (vm.js:80:10)
    at Object.runInThisContext (vm.js:139:10)
    at Module._compile (module.js:616:28)
    at Object.Module._extensions..js (module.js:663:10)
    at Module.load (module.js:565:32)
    at tryModuleLoad (module.js:505:12)
    at Function.Module._load (module.js:497:3)
    at Module.require (module.js:596:17)
    at require (internal/module.js:11:18)
    at Object.<anonymous> (/Users/craigyu/Downloads/steamWorkshopCrawler/steamworkshopdownloader-master/node_modules/jsdom/lib/jsdom/living/helpers/form-controls.js:18:5)
npm ERR! code ELIFECYCLE
npm ERR! errno 1
npm ERR! batchdownload@1.0.0 start: `node index.js`
npm ERR! Exit status 1
npm ERR! 
npm ERR! Failed at the batchdownload@1.0.0 start script.
npm ERR! This is probably not a problem with npm. There is likely additional logging output above.```
ronram5126 commented 4 years ago

Hi Craigyu, sorry for delay. I have written this program very specifically. Could you please provide me the link to the workshop collection, I will test it and let you know.

craigyu commented 4 years ago

Hi, I already downloaded the files i need.

Here is the list of urls i used

https://steamcommunity.com/sharedfiles/filedetails/?id=911613539 https://steamcommunity.com/sharedfiles/filedetails/?id=531136613 https://steamcommunity.com/sharedfiles/filedetails/?id=947425570 https://steamcommunity.com/sharedfiles/filedetails/?id=680500415 https://steamcommunity.com/sharedfiles/filedetails/?id=691602861 https://steamcommunity.com/sharedfiles/filedetails/?id=429618056 https://steamcommunity.com/sharedfiles/filedetails/?id=427881811 https://steamcommunity.com/sharedfiles/filedetails/?id=678159892 https://steamcommunity.com/sharedfiles/filedetails/?id=526405282 https://steamcommunity.com/sharedfiles/filedetails/?id=1128919057 https://steamcommunity.com/sharedfiles/filedetails/?id=1812686836 https://steamcommunity.com/sharedfiles/filedetails/?id=1817611557 https://steamcommunity.com/sharedfiles/filedetails/?id=1832545585 https://steamcommunity.com/sharedfiles/filedetails/?id=1837236476 https://steamcommunity.com/sharedfiles/filedetails/?id=1860794227 https://steamcommunity.com/sharedfiles/filedetails/?id=1859290535 https://steamcommunity.com/sharedfiles/filedetails/?id=1859284188 https://steamcommunity.com/sharedfiles/filedetails/?id=1910177240 https://steamcommunity.com/sharedfiles/filedetails/?id=1883853907 https://steamcommunity.com/sharedfiles/filedetails/?id=1883855665 https://steamcommunity.com/sharedfiles/filedetails/?id=1897405591 https://steamcommunity.com/sharedfiles/filedetails/?id=1897406756 https://steamcommunity.com/sharedfiles/filedetails/?id=1886334945 https://steamcommunity.com/sharedfiles/filedetails/?id=1892983429 https://steamcommunity.com/sharedfiles/filedetails/?id=1890003393 https://steamcommunity.com/sharedfiles/filedetails/?id=1911328552 https://steamcommunity.com/sharedfiles/filedetails/?id=1225368249 https://steamcommunity.com/sharedfiles/filedetails/?id=739596970 https://steamcommunity.com/sharedfiles/filedetails/?id=612529562 https://steamcommunity.com/sharedfiles/filedetails/?id=1819666472 https://steamcommunity.com/sharedfiles/filedetails/?id=1937517089 https://steamcommunity.com/sharedfiles/filedetails/?id=1938795804 https://steamcommunity.com/sharedfiles/filedetails/?id=1945995597 https://steamcommunity.com/sharedfiles/filedetails/?id=1949792902 https://steamcommunity.com/sharedfiles/filedetails/?id=1964804537 https://steamcommunity.com/sharedfiles/filedetails/?id=1969532380

I wanted to download everything in this collection https://steamcommunity.com/workshop/filedetails/?id=1817583362 but i saw the url format is not the same as the ones in your example

It's NBD, just thought you might wanna know

ronram5126 commented 4 years ago

hi craigyu, I have fixed it to be able to download collection just add the url of colelction (not the url of the packages in the collection) in the urls.txt and try it. Sorry for delay mate, I was caught up trying to fix my pc.

Cheer man, be safe. Ronit

craigyu commented 4 years ago

nice work dude, i saw your post on reddit, thought it's designed for downloading collection, maybe I read it wrong 😅 and stay safe yourself too, cheers